Job Title: Band 6 Diabetes Specialist Midwife

An exciting opportunity has arisen within our maternity service. You will be working as part of the Diabetes in Pregnancy multidisciplinary team.


Main duties of the job

1. Provide high-quality, safe midwifery care to women and their families whose pregnancy is complicated by Diabetes.
2. Develop a high level of relevant expert knowledge and skills in the care of women with Diabetes in pregnancy.
3. Manage, develop, and lead care for pregnant women and new mothers with additional needs.
4. Provide direct client care and support women with Diabetes in partnership with the Diabetes Specialist Lead Midwife and the multidisciplinary team.
5. Work closely with women and their families to plan and coordinate care based on individual needs.
6. Assist the Diabetes Specialist Lead Midwife to ensure high standards of quality care are delivered and maintained.
7. Promote quality improvement methods among frontline staff to improve patient care.
8. Act as a resource of Diabetes specialist knowledge to team members.


About us

Bolton NHS Foundation Trust offers services across the North West side of Greater Manchester, including hospital and community services. We are a progressive, expanding organisation with a focus on quality, pathway integration, and productivity. Over 5,700 staff work here, many for a long time, providing fulfilling healthcare careers.

The Family Division delivers high standards in maternity, sexual health, gynaecology, and children's services. We are a Centre of Excellence for Women's and Children's services, delivering over 6,000 babies annually and performing around 1,500 gynaecological procedures each year.

With approximately 6,000 births per year, Bolton is a 'Supercentre' for the northwest, providing high-quality, compassionate care to women in Bolton, Bury, Salford, and beyond.

Person Specification


Qualifications

* Midwifery Degree
* NMC Registered Midwife
* Evidence of continued professional development
* Willingness to undertake relevant courses/training, including further study in Diabetes in pregnancy
* Non-medical prescribing course


Experience

* Band 6 midwife experience
* Experience working with pregnant or newly delivered women with diabetes
* Experience in care assessment, planning, and evaluation
* Basic knowledge of Diabetes in pregnancy
* Awareness of national and local drivers regarding diabetes in pregnancy
* Experience within a Diabetes MDT
* Experience in data collection, policy writing, and service audit
* Knowledge of local services for women with diabetes during pregnancy


Skills

* Excellent verbal and written communication skills
* Ability to organise, prioritise, and meet deadlines
* Accurate record-keeping skills
* Positive response to sensitive situations
* Flexibility to meet service demands
* Independent working and effective team collaboration
